Public speaking is a skill that many strive to master, but receiving criticism from peers can be a challenging experience. Whether you're delivering a presentation at work or speaking at a community event, the feedback you receive can significantly impact your confidence and performance. It's essential to approach criticism constructively, using it as a stepping stone to enhance your public speaking abilities. When faced with negative comments, remember that every speaker, no matter how experienced, has room for improvement. Your response to criticism can define your growth as a public speaker and help you connect more effectively with your audience in the future.
